About Marimo: At Marimo, we're building the best open-source environment for working with data, alongside a world-class cloud platform designed for scale, performance, and collaboration. Marimo reimagines the Python notebook from first principles. It combines the interactivity of a next-generation reactive notebook with the flexibility of pure Python: notebooks can be versioned with Git, deployed as data applications, executed as scripts, and imported as reusable modules. Originally incubated with scientists at Stanford, marimo is now used by leading companies, research labs, and universities worldwide, with millions of downloads and more than 17,000 GitHub stars. We believe that the tools we use shape the way we think. Better tools lead to better ideas, faster iteration, and deeper understanding. If you're passionate about developer tools, thrive in ambiguous environments, enjoy tackling challenging engineering problems, and are excited by greenfield opportunities, you'll fit right in. About the Team: The molab team at Marimo develops a cloud-hosted marimo notebook service called molab. molab lets anyone in the world experiment with data, build interactive apps, and share their work for free, all using the open-source marimo notebook and accelerated by AI-assisted coding. This is a high impact team and product, undergoing rapid growth and working on many challenging greenfield problems — with an emphasis on building highly available, low latency and fault tolerant systems. About the Role: As a Staff Engineer on Marimo's molab team, you will co-design and implement the backend architecture of molab, solving for high availability, low latency (both the ability to rapidly spin up and spin down notebook kernels on demand, as well as low latency communication between the notebook frontend and backend), stability, and fraud and abuse. You will design molab to run on CoreWeave's specialized kubernetes-based clusters and integrate with CoreWeave object storage, and will solve for keeping utilization of GPUs high. What You'll Do You'll be joining the Launch & Sandboxes team within the ML Workflows organization. Our team owns two interconnected product areas: Sandboxes, W&B's cloud execution environments that let ML practitioners run code in isolated, GPU-enabled containers directly from the W&B platform, and Launch, which handles job launching, compute orchestration, and integration with HPC schedulers. We build the infrastructure that connects W&B's experiment tracking and model development tools to the actual compute where ML work happens, spanning Kubernetes clusters, HPC nodes, and cloud VMs. About the role As a Senior Engineer on the Launch & Sandboxes team, you'll work across the full stack of our execution infrastructure, from the backend services that manage sandbox orchestration and billing to the Python SDK that ML practitioners interact with daily. Your day-to-day will involve building and scaling our container orchestration layer, developing SDK integrations that make sandboxes a seamless part of the W&B workflow, and extending our compute integrations for HPC customers. You'll work on real distributed systems problems: container lifecycle management, federated authentication, usage-based billing, and secrets management. This is a backend-heavy role (70% Go, 20% Python, 10% TypeScript/React) where you'll operate across multiple services and occasionally debug infrastructure issues in production. As a Regional Inventory Control Manager, you will lead the inventory control program across a cluster of data centers and 1PL locations within your region. You will be accountable for regional inventory accuracy, discrepancy aging, audit readiness, and the performance and development of the Inventory Control Specialists (ICS) and site IC leads under your span. You will turn standards and playbooks into day‑to‑day execution at sites, ensuring that serialized assets, spares, and project materials are controlled with hyperscaler‑grade rigor. Core Duties • Own regional inventory accuracy, discrepancy aging, and audit outcomes for Inventory Control. • Lead, coach, and develop Inventory Control Specialists (ICS) and site IC leads across multiple data centers and 1PL locations. • Standardize and enforce inventory control SOPs, cycle count programs, and reconciliation routines across your region. • Partner with Data Center Operations, Global Logistics, Finance, and Security to ensure SOX‑ready controls, clean handoffs, and clear accountabilities. • Use data and KPIs to identify gaps, drive corrective actions (RCA/CAPA), and deliver measurable improvements in control, speed, and quality. About The Role We are looking for a hands‑on regional manager who can move comfortably between the floor and leadership rooms. You will spend time with ICS teams at sites, in the systems (NetSuite, asset tools, WMS), and in reviews with DC Ops and Finance. This is a people‑leadership role with regional scope and strong cross‑functional influence. You will shape how CoreWeave protects billions of dollars of assets, from initial receipt through their lifecycle in our data centers. Team Leadership and Development • Directly manage Inventory Control Specialists and/or Area IC Managers across your region. • Own hiring, onboarding, training, and performance reviews for IC roles in your span. • Build a strong IC culture around accuracy, documentation, safety, and cross‑functional partnership. • Identify high‑potential ICs and develop them into leads/supervisors to improve span of control at large or complex sites. Operational Execution and Standards • Ensure consistent implementation of IC SOPs, policies, and MFCP/5S standards across all sites in your region. • Monitor daily IC activities (receiving controls, tagging, binning, moves, cycle counts, RMAs, documentation) via system reports and site reviews. • Partner with DC Ops leads to align work order consumption, spares flows, and floor‑ready material control with IC routines. Inventory Control, Counts, and Reconciliation • Own the regional cycle count and physical inventory schedule, making sure all required counts are executed on time and to standard. • Review variance reports, drive investigation quality, and ensure discrepancies are closed within SLA (e.g., 7–14 days depending on severity). • Ensure that NetSuite, asset systems, and any WMS reflect accurate, reconciled inventory positions across your sites. • Coordinate with Finance and Audit on annual physicals, SOX testing, and remediation. Governance, KPIs, and Continuous Improvement • Define and manage regional IC KPIs, including: • Inventory accuracy (by count and value) • Discrepancy aging (median, P90) • Investigation closure rate within SLA • Audit findings (count, severity, and on‑time closure) • Run regular regional IC reviews with DC Ops, Finance, and GLO leadership; publish KPI packs and action plans. • Identify systemic issues (e.g., labeling, process gaps, tooling pain points) and lead regional improvement initiatives in partnership with the Global IC Program Manager and GLO. Cross‑Functional Collaboration • Serve as the primary IC point of contact for your region with: • Data Center Operations leadership • Global Logistics (warehousing, transportation, 3PL / 1PL) • Finance/Accounting and Audit • Security and EHS, where IC touches physical controls • Ensure clear RACI and escalation paths for IC issues (e.g., missing assets, documentation gaps, SOX concerns).
